UK's leading political party declares war on "Net Zero" CO2 policy | Eastern North Carolina Now

Reform Party says climate policies leading to de-industrialization of Britain

ENCNow

The UK's upstart Reform Party, led by Brexit hero Nigel Farage, is increasingly targeting Labour's "Net Zero" CO2 policies in its political message.  Multiple recent polls have shown an explosion of support for the Reform Party, which has rocketed to become the UK's most popular political party among voters.  The latest poll, out today puts Reform at 29%, Labour at 23%, and Conservatives at 21%,  with Scottish Nationalists, Welsh Nationalists, Liberal Democrats, Greens, and assorted Northern Ireland parties getting the balance.

Party leader Farage, who is MP for Clacton, declared at a press conference that "we view the Net Zero targets as the prime reason for the de-industrialization of Britain."  Farage announced that Reform would target wind and solar energy companies with a new tax, the proceeds of which would be distributed to electric ratepayers whose electric bills are going through the roof due to "green energy". Farage is a longtime advocate of nuclear energy as well as supporting development of the UK's oil and gas reserves, including allowing fracking.

While the Reform Party has always been sceptical of green energy and Net Zero which is deputy leader has long dubbed "Net Stupid", it is now doubling down on this issue in its messaging.   This also separatves Reform from its rivals on the right, the Conservative Party, which although much less ectreme on the issue, has paid at least lip service to the Net Zero concept.

Opposition to "green energy" proved extremely popular with voters in the last provincial election in the Canadian province of Ontario, Canada's largest.  Newly minted Conservative Party leader Doug Ford zeroed in on unpopular and expennsive green energy as the main message in his campaign.  The result was the biggest landslide election flip in Canada's history, flipping a 2 to 1 Liberal over Conservative majority to a 10 to 1 Conservative over Liberal majority.  As premier of Ontario, Ford's first move was to cancel all wind and solar permit applications then in the pipeline, followed by repeal of the Green Energy Act itself.  His govenrment also restored local government authority to block wind and solar projects, cancelled wind and solar projects already under construction with the savings from not having to pay for subsidies more than covering the contractual penalties, and helped local victims obtain the evidence to have four wind energy companies criminally indicted for multiple felonies of polluting the groundwater.
